Auxerre II is the reserve team of AJ Auxerre, a prominent football club based in Auxerre, France. Competing in the lower divisions of French football, Auxerre II serves as a vital platform for developing young talent and providing a pathway for aspiring players to progress to the first team. The team is known for its commitment to nurturing homegrown players, emphasizing skill development, teamwork, and tactical awareness.
Playing their home matches at the club's training facility, Auxerre II boasts a dedicated fan base that supports the next generation of footballers. The team's colors and crest reflect the rich history and tradition of AJ Auxerre, a club with a storied past in French football, including a successful run in Ligue 1 and participation in European competitions.
Auxerre II's coaching staff focuses on instilling a strong work ethic and a competitive spirit, aiming to prepare players for the challenges of professional football. The team's participation in regional leagues and cup competitions allows young athletes to gain valuable experience and showcase their abilities on the pitch, making them potential candidates for promotion to the senior squad. Overall, Auxerre II plays a crucial role in the club's long-term vision of success and sustainability in French football.
